Division I - Boys

1. St. Ignatius (4-0) – Total Points: 100

2. Columbus St. Charles Prep (6-0-0) – Total Points: 85

3. Mason (5-0-0) – Total Points: 79

4. Beavercreek (5-0-0) – Total Points: 67

5. Dublin Coffman (5-0) – Total Points: 59

6. Medina (2-0-1) – Total Points: 48

7. Whitehouse Anthony Wayne (4-1-1) – Total Points: 38

8. Olmsted Falls (5-0-0) – Total Points: 34

9 Cincinnati Anderson (5-0-1) – Total Points: 26

10. Copley (4-1-1) – Total Points: 9

Receiving votes: Shaker Heights, Toledo St. Francis de Sales, Toledo St. Johns Jesuit, Westerville Central
